Once you have received a government student loan, it is your responsibility to:
understand and respect the terms and conditions spelled out in detail in your loan agreement
tell your lender and the student financial assistance officer at your school or provincial student assistance office of any changes in your situation such as a change in name or marital status, a change in your status as a full- or part-time student, or a change of address
provide your lender with proof of enrollment for each study period that you are enrolled, even if you are not applying for a new loan
keep track of the amounts you borrow each year
see your lender and complete a Consolidated Student Loan Agreement within six months of ceasing to be a student
repay your student loan. If you are a full-time student, you will be required to start repayment of your student loan on the last day of the seventh month after ceasing to be a student. However, you can start repayment earlier if you are in a position to do so. If you are a part-time student, you are required to make interest payments even while enrolled, and start full repayment on the last day of the seventh month after ceasing to be a student
